In the first part of our series, we introduced Chronos-2, a foundational model for time series. We explored a concrete case study, observing what Chronos-2 can achieve right out of the box, without prior training. However, while zero-shot capabilities are powerful, they show limitations in certain contexts, necessitating model fine-tuning for better results.

Five Methods to Optimize Chronos-2

Fine-tuning Chronos-2 can be accomplished through several proven techniques:

  • Hyperparameter tuning: By modifying hyperparameters, the model can be adapted to better respond to the specifics of certain datasets, thereby improving its performance.

  • Supervised training: By using labeled data, Chronos-2 can be trained to more effectively recognize trends and patterns present in time series.

  • Augmented datasets: Enriching the dataset with additional examples or variations can help the model generalize better, increasing its robustness.

  • Transfer learning: By leveraging pre-trained models on similar tasks, the fine-tuning of Chronos-2 can be accelerated while improving the results obtained.

  • Continuous evaluation: Implementing a continuous evaluation system allows for monitoring the model's performance and adjusting fine-tuning strategies based on observed results.

These approaches significantly enhance the effectiveness of Chronos-2, making it better suited to meet the specific demands of users across various application contexts.
